Factors Affecting Solar Battery Charge Speed
Your solar batteries aren't just lazy energy hoarders - they're picky eaters. Their charging speed depends on:
- Sunlight intensity: Like solar-powered vampires, they charge faster under direct sunlight
- Battery temperature: Most batteries prefer Goldilocks conditions - not too hot, not too cold
- Charger type: MPPT controllers vs. PWM - it's the Tesla vs. bicycle debate of solar tech
- Battery chemistry: Lithium-ion batteries charge faster than their lead-acid cousins (but cost more than your avocado toast habit)

Industry Jargon Decoded
Don't let these terms shock you:
- State of Charge (SoC): Battery's "gas gauge"
- C-rate: Charging speed relative to battery capacity
- Depth of Discharge (DoD): How low you can go before recharging
Pro tip: Maintaining 20-80% charge is like keeping your phone battery happy - except solar batteries don't judge your TikTok usage.

The Cloudy Day Conundrum
Cloudy weather doesn't mean zero charging - modern panels can still harness diffuse light. It's like making weak coffee versus espresso, but hey, caffeine is caffeine! Consider it nature's dimmer switch.
